Ten Occasions That Justify Limousine Service Beyond Weddings and Proms
Milton Walker Jr., owner of Alert Transportation in New Orleans, outlines ten events where limousine service plays a functional role, offering a smooth, coordinated experience from start to finish.
“Limousine transportation is often thought of as a luxury reserved for special ceremonies, but it also solves real-world challenges like parking, timing, and group mobility across multiple venues,” said Walker.
1. Corporate Meetings and Conferences
Group transportation for corporate guests ensures timely arrival, consistent branding, and coordinated movement between hotels, venues, and restaurants. Professional drivers manage traffic and scheduling so clients, executives, or team members remain focused on business.
2. Airport Transfers for VIP Clients
Airport pickups and drop-offs for executives, speakers, or entertainers require punctuality and professionalism. Using a limousine for airport service reduces the uncertainty of rideshare availability, offers a more controlled environment, and helps ensure a seamless introduction to any city visit.
3. Bachelor and Bachelorette Parties
Coordinating transportation for nightlife-based events across bars, clubs, or venues eliminates the need for designated drivers and improves group safety. Door-to-door service allows attendees to focus on the event without navigating routes or parking.
4. Concerts and Sporting Events
Venues such as the Smoothie King Center, Caesars Superdome, and outdoor festival locations in New Orleans experience high traffic and limited parking during large-scale events. Group transportation alleviates parking challenges, reduces walking distances, and allows for timely arrival.
5. Graduation Ceremonies
Graduations mark a milestone for both students and families. Coordinated transportation for extended family and guests ensures attendance at the ceremony without the stress of separate vehicles or traffic concerns. Limo service also provides a memorable experience for graduates and their guests.
6. Anniversary Celebrations
Couples marking significant anniversaries often plan special evenings that include fine dining, entertainment, or revisiting important locations. A limousine provides uninterrupted time together and removes concerns over driving, directions, or parking.
7. Funeral and Memorial Services
Limousine service during funeral arrangements provides coordinated transport for family members, ensuring respectful, timely arrival to services and receptions. The use of professional transportation supports a smooth flow during emotionally difficult times.
8. Quinceañeras and Sweet Sixteen Parties
Family celebrations like quinceañeras and sweet sixteen events typically involve formal venues, photo shoots, and group activities. Limousines accommodate transportation between venues and provide a central meeting point for participants, minimizing scheduling issues.
9. City Tours for Out-of-Town Guests
Limousine service offers a structured way to introduce out-of-town guests to the Greater New Orleans Area, including the French Quarter, Garden District, and local attractions. Custom routes can be designed to match sightseeing preferences, with added comfort and local navigation handled by trained professionals.
10. Retirement Parties
For professionals transitioning into retirement, an evening out with colleagues or family may involve multiple stops or a large group. Limousine service helps manage movement between venues, whether the evening includes dinner, awards, or a surprise gathering.
Limousine service is not limited to symbolic milestones. In New Orleans and surrounding parishes, it is also a practical solution for events that require structured timing, multi-location coordination, and organized group logistics. While many still associate limos with prom photos and wedding day portraits, the increasing use of transportation services for everyday occasions reflects the evolving role of professional vehicle service.
Factors influencing the decision to book a limo include traffic patterns, local event congestion, safety considerations, and the desire for a centralized, coordinated transportation plan. As more venues adopt timed entry, valet restrictions, or permit-only drop-offs, professionally managed transport ensures compliance with these requirements while enhancing overall experience.
In areas like the French Quarter or Warehouse District, where parking is limited and traffic congestion is common during festivals or public events, limousine service can eliminate unnecessary delays and stress. The ability to load and unload directly at entry points streamlines movement and supports efficient transitions between events.

Kolejne 9 mld zł trafi na budowę i modernizację sieci energetycznych. Inwestycje pomogą wyeliminować ryzyko blackoutu
Modernizacja i cyfryzacja sieci to dziś jeden z priorytetów spółek energetycznych w Polsce. Inwestycje te wzmacniają odporność systemu elektroenergetycznego i ograniczają ryzyko blackoutu, analogicznego do tego, który niedawno miał miejsce w Hiszpanii, ale też umożliwiają przyłączenie większej ilości zielonych źródeł energii. Enea pozyskała właśnie niskooprocentowaną pożyczkę w ramach KPO w wysokości 9 mld zł, które przeznaczy na budowę i modernizację sieci w północnej i zachodniej Polsce.

Gminne komisje szacują już straty w uprawach spowodowane przez majowe przymrozki. Najbardziej poszkodowani są sadownicy

W maju przygruntowe przymrozki pojawiły się na terenie niemal całego kraju. W niektórych miejscach temperatura obniżała się nawet do kilku stopni na minusie. Straty w rolnictwie i sadownictwie są bardzo duże, w niektórych regionach kraju sięgają nawet 90 proc. Ucierpiały nie tylko owoce i zboża, ale też część warzyw. Trwają już przygotowania naborów dla rolników, którzy ponieśli straty w wyniku przymrozków.

Kampania prezydencka na ostatniej prostej. Temat ochrony zdrowia na drugim planie

Zdaniem przedstawicieli Naczelnej Izby Lekarskiej temat ochrony zdrowia w kampanii prezydenckiej, prowadzonej przed I turą wyborów, zszedł na dalszy plan. Kandydaci na najwyższy urząd w Polsce nie podawali – poza tematem składki zdrowotnej – w tym obszarze konkretów, a skupili się na kampanijnych ogólnikach i zapewnieniach. Zabrakło poruszenia wielu ważnych kwestii dotyczących m.in. przyszłości zawodów medycznych, kształcenia lekarzy, walki z agresją wobec medyków czy pomysłów na skrócenie kolejek do specjalistów i poprawy finansowania.
